Hasnat Abdullah, the National Citizens Party (NCP) candidate of the Jamaat-led alliance in the Comilla-4 (Debidwar) constituency, on Sunday said that if elected in the upcoming national election, he would make Bangladesh “the next hell for loan defaulters.”

He made the remark reacting to the Appellate Division’s order rejecting a leave to appeal filed by BNP-nominated candidate Manjurul Ahsan Munshi to regain his candidacy in the Comilla-4 constituency.

“This is a message for bank robbers and loan defaulters. If elected, I will make Bangladesh the next hell for loan defaulters,” Hasnat said.

Earlier in the day, the Appellate Division, headed by the chief justice, rejected Munshi’s leave to appeal against a High Court order, effectively barring him from contesting the 13th national parliamentary election, according to his lawyers.

The High Court on January 21 dismissed a writ petition filed by Munshi challenging the Election Commission’s (EC) decision to cancel his nomination. The bench comprised Justice Razik Al Jalil and Justice Md Anwarul Islam.

Munshi was represented in court by Advocate Ahsanul Karim, Barrister Hamidul Misbah and Advocate Saifullah Al Mamun, while Hasnat Abdullah was represented by Barrister Ehsan Abdullah Siddique, Advocate Zahirul Islam Musa and Advocate Mujahidul Islam Shaheen.

Earlier, the returning officer had initially declared Munshi’s nomination papers valid. Hasnat Abdullah subsequently appealed to the EC, alleging that the BNP candidate had concealed information about being a loan defaulter.

After a hearing at the Election Building in Agargaon on January 17, the EC upheld Hasnat’s appeal and declared Munshi’s nomination invalid.

Munshi later filed a writ petition seeking to stay the EC’s decision and restore his candidacy, which was dismissed by the High Court, followed by the rejection of his appeal in the Appellate Division.
